2Baba Speaks Out: “I’m Not Mentally Unstable” — A Deep Dive Into The Family Feud and Public Fallout

By Umeh Ukamaka Augusta

Innocent “2Baba” Idibia has broken his silence amid a highly public family dispute and a petition his relatives filed against his current partner. In a video released online, the veteran musician denied claims that he is mentally unstable, described recent events as “dangerous,” and said his family’s actions have harmed both his reputation and the safety of people close to him.

What 2Baba said — the core message

In a direct video message shared online, 2Baba told followers he is "okay" and urged people to stop portraying him as mentally unstable. He said the narrative being pushed by some family members and former associates is both false and damaging — equating the false portrayal to “killing somebody” because of the way it destroys reputations and exposes loved ones to threats. He also said his current partner, Natasha Osawaru, has received death threats as a result of the public fallout. 0

The immediate trigger: family petition and allegations

Public interest in the family’s actions intensified after a petition from members of the Idibia family surfaced, addressed to law enforcement (the IGP). The petition reportedly accuses Natasha of various allegations including assault and financial impropriety, and asks for official investigation. The petition, dated in November, became a focal point for public debate and media coverage. 1

“My family did this same thing with Annie,” 2Baba said, accusing relatives of trying to “save” him but instead causing harm to relationships and reputations. 2

Timeline: How events escalated in 2025

January – April 2025

2Baba and Annie Idibia publicly announced their separation earlier in the year, a story that dominated entertainment news and set the stage for later developments. 3

Mid / Late 2025

2Baba’s relationship with Natasha Osawaru and subsequent family objections drew fresh scrutiny. A petition from family members to the IGP, and public statements from both sides, turned the dispute into a headline issue across major Nigerian outlets. 4

Early December 2025

2Baba released the video statement denying claims of mental instability and warning that the attacks had become dangerous — particularly noting threats directed at his partner. Media outlets quickly picked up the video, reproducing parts of his remarks and reporting on the family petition. 5

Why this matters — Reputation, safety and the public gaze

At stake in this story are more than celebrity headlines: the claims and counterclaims touch on personal reputation, the safety of family members and partners, and how private disputes are handled in the public arena. When influential voices — family members, the media, and lawmakers — intervene in intimate matters, the results can rapidly spiral into harassment or even threats. 2Baba’s public plea for calm is an appeal for privacy and for the public to stop amplifying potentially harmful narratives. 6

How the media and social platforms amplified the dispute

Video snippets, petitions posted online, commentary from pundits, and social media posts accelerated public interest. In many cases, hearsay and unverified statements spread faster than official responses. That dynamic complicates conflict resolution: once rumours go viral, reputational damage and threats can be difficult to reverse. Multiple outlets published coverage of both the petition and 2Baba’s response. 7

Questions that remain

  • Will the IGP formally respond to the petition and publish findings? (The petition itself was reported in news outlets.) 8
  • Will family members and 2Baba engage in mediation or a public forum to resolve the dispute? — no formal mediation announcement has been reported at the time of writing.
  • How will online platforms and journalists verify sensitive claims before republishing them? The episode highlights the need for careful fact-checking.

Takeaway

Based on multiple news reports and 2Baba’s own video statement, it is accurate to say that the singer publicly denied claims of mental instability and described a campaign by some family members and associates as damaging and dangerous. At the same time, family members have lodged formal complaints that have been reported in the press, so competing narratives exist in the public domain. Readers should treat ongoing developments cautiously and await any official statements or legal determinations for a fuller picture. 9
